You must meet the following requirements by the closing date of this announcement.
Specialized ExperienceFor the GS-14, you must have one year (full 52 weeks) of specialized experience at a level of difficulty and responsibility equivalent to the GS-13 grade level in the Federal service. Specialized experience for this position is defined as:
- Experience directing IT programs or projects with enterprise-wide impact, including responsibility for managing scope, schedule, cost, performance, and quality throughout the systems development life‑cycle. Experience may include oversight of software development initiatives, cloud service implementations, infrastructure modernization efforts, or enterprise information technology systems.
AND
- Implementing or managing scaled Agile frameworks and practices across multiple teams, projects, or programs, including Agile portfolio management, PI Planning, Agile Release Trains, or related enterprise Agile methodologies.
OR - Managing interdependencies among multiple concurrent IT programs or initiatives, including balancing competing priorities, mitigating risks, allocating resources, and integrating program activities to achieve organizational objectives.
OR - Advising senior executives, governance boards, or organizational leadership on IT investment strategies, enterprise risk, strategic alignment, or technology modernization efforts, including presenting recommendations that informed executive decision‑making.
OR - Applying product management and outcome‑driven delivery principles, including roadmap development, minimum viable product (MVP) strategies, performance metrics, or value delivery approaches to align IT investments with mission or business objectives.
The experience may have been gained in either the public, private sector or volunteer service. One year of experience refers to full‑time work; part‑time work is considered on a prorated basis. To ensure full credit for your work experience, please indicate dates of employment by month/day/year, and indicate number of hours worked per week on your resume.
